Genesis 1:12

The earth brought forth grass, herbs yielding seed after their kind, and trees bearing fruit, with its seed in it, after their kind; and God saw that it was good.

Isaiah 55:10-11

For as the rain comes down and the snow from the sky, and doesn't return there, but waters the earth, and makes it bring forth and bud, and gives seed to the sower and bread to the eater;

Isaiah 61:11

For as the earth brings forth its bud, and as the garden causes the things that are sown in it to spring forth; so the Lord GOD will cause righteousness and praise to spring forth before all the nations.

Matthew 13:24-26

He set another parable before them, saying, "The Kingdom of Heaven is like a man who sowed good seed in his field,

Mark 4:28

For the earth bears fruit: first the blade, then the ear, then the full grain in the ear.

Luke 6:44

For each tree is known by its own fruit. For people do not gather figs from thorns, nor do they gather grapes from a bramble bush.

2 Corinthians 9:10

Now he who supplies seed to the sower and bread for food, will supply and multiply your seed for sowing, and increase the fruits of your righteousness;

Galatians 6:7

Do not be deceived. God is not mocked, for whatever a man sows, that he will also reap.
